摘要:考研真題,是用來(lái)研究考試規(guī)律的。考生可通過(guò)真題,來(lái)確定自己的復(fù)習(xí)范圍,來(lái)研究考試的重點(diǎn)、難點(diǎn)是哪些內(nèi)容。希賽網(wǎng)為大家整理2022年C/C++語(yǔ)言程序設(shè)計(jì)考研真題答案及解析,供大家參考!
本文提供2022年C/C++語(yǔ)言程序設(shè)計(jì)考研真題答案及解析,以下為具體內(nèi)容
1、在下面有關(guān)對(duì)構(gòu)造函數(shù)的描述中,正確的是:( )。
A、構(gòu)造函數(shù)必須帶參數(shù)
B、構(gòu)造函數(shù)可以帶返回值
C、構(gòu)造函數(shù)的名字與類名完全相同
D、構(gòu)造函數(shù)必須定義,不能默認(rèn)
2、具有轉(zhuǎn)換函數(shù)功能的構(gòu)造函數(shù),應(yīng)該是( )。
A、不帶參數(shù)的構(gòu)造函數(shù)
B、帶有一個(gè)參數(shù)的構(gòu)造函數(shù)
C、帶有兩個(gè)以上參數(shù)的構(gòu)造函數(shù)
D、缺省構(gòu)造函數(shù)
3、友元的作用之一是:( )。
A、增加成員函數(shù)的種類
B、加強(qiáng)類的封裝性
C、提高程序的運(yùn)行效率
D、實(shí)現(xiàn)數(shù)據(jù)的隱藏性
4、下列描述中,( ) 是錯(cuò)誤的。
A、對(duì)內(nèi)聯(lián)函數(shù)不可以進(jìn)行異常接口聲明
B、內(nèi)聯(lián)函數(shù)的定義必須現(xiàn)在內(nèi)聯(lián)函數(shù)第一次被調(diào)用之前
C、內(nèi)聯(lián)函數(shù)主要解決程序的運(yùn)行效率問(wèn)題
D、內(nèi)聯(lián)函數(shù)中可以包括各種語(yǔ)句
5、在C++語(yǔ)言中,關(guān)于類與對(duì)象說(shuō)法中,錯(cuò)誤的是( )。
A、在面向?qū)ο蟪绦蛟O(shè)計(jì)中,總是先聲明對(duì)象,再由對(duì)象生成類.
B、類中的操作是用函數(shù)來(lái)實(shí)現(xiàn)的,稱為成員函數(shù)
C、把類的數(shù)據(jù)稱為數(shù)據(jù)成員
D、類和對(duì)象之間的關(guān)系是抽象和具體的關(guān)系
6、執(zhí)行以下程序段后,輸出結(jié)果和a的值是( )。int a=10; printf("%d",a++);
A、11和10
B、10和11
C、11和11
D、10和10
7、以下不正確的if語(yǔ)句形式是( )。
A、if(x<y) {x++;y++;}
B、if(x!=y) scanf(" %d",&x) else scanf("%d",&y);
C、if(x> y&&x!=y);
D、if(x==y) x+=y;
8、static char str[ 10]="China" ;數(shù)組元素個(gè)數(shù)為( )。
A、6
B、9
C、5
D、10
9、int a[10];合法的數(shù)組元素的最小下標(biāo)值為( )。
A、10
B、9
C、1
D、0
點(diǎn)擊查看【完整】試卷>>考研備考資料免費(fèi)領(lǐng)取
去領(lǐng)取
共收錄117.93萬(wàn)道題
已有25.02萬(wàn)小伙伴參與做題